#5480a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5480a4 is composed of 32.9% red, 50.2%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.8% cyan, 22%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 207 degrees, a saturation of 32.3% and a lightness of 48.6%. #5480a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#000149.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#5480a4 color description : Dark moderate blue.

#5480a4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5480a4 has RGB values of R:84, G:128,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 5537956.

Shades and Tints of #5480a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040708 is the darkest color, while #fafc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5480a4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7c7e is the less saturated color, while #0888f0 is the most saturated one.
